[發明專利]一種基于傳感器的牙齒區域識別算法的刷牙引導系統有效
| 申請號: | 202210414511.2 | 申請日: | 2022-04-20 |
| 公開(公告)號: | CN114699200B | 公開(公告)日: | 2023-09-22 |
| 發明(設計)人: | 李善忠 | 申請(專利權)人: | 中山極冠科技有限公司 |
| 主分類號: | A61C17/22 | 分類號: | A61C17/22;G06T17/00 |
| 代理公司: | 中山市科創專利代理有限公司 44211 | 代理人: | 謝自成 |
| 地址: | 528400 廣東省中*** | 國省代碼: | 廣東;44 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 基于 傳感器 牙齒 區域 識別 算法 刷牙 引導 系統 | ||
1.一種基于傳感器的牙齒區域識別算法的刷牙引導系統,其特征在于其包括步驟一:采集傳感器數據;步驟二:牙齒區域檢測識別;步驟三:建立3d牙齒模型,根據計算得出的覆蓋率渲染牙齒模型并展示;
所述步驟一采集傳感器數據包括:
1.1:將陀螺儀傳感器的加速度三軸數據抽象化為一個個球體,并且定義一個數據結構Sphere,包含的字段為球體的x,y,z軸,球體半徑的平方Squared_Radius;
1.2:將牙齒區域劃分為16個區域;
1.3:用電動牙刷固定刷其中一個牙齒區域,同時采集陀螺儀傳感器的加速度三軸數據acceleration_x,acceleration_y,acceleration_z,并保存到數據結構Sphere的x,y,z中;
1.4:再次用電動牙刷固定刷S2中的牙齒區域,并通過計算公式:Squared_Radius=(acceleration_x-x)2+(acceleration_y-y)2+(acce?leration_y-y)2得出Squared_Radius,至此16個牙齒區域,數據采集流程已完成;
所述步驟二牙齒區域檢測識別包括:
2.1:定義一個數據結構KL_Brushing_Zone,其中包含齒區標識zone_key,可以在后面的齒區相似度算法中篩選出匹配的Sphere,從而計算得當前實時刷牙的牙齒區域,定義一個容器passes,用于保存當前刷牙區域的有效時間片段;
2.2:實時獲取傳感器加速計的4條加速度數據,并計算出平均加速度average_x,average_y,average_z;
2.3:根據齒區相似度匹配算法公式:Kl_Squared_Radius=(average_x-x)2+(average_y-y)2+(average_z-y)2;計算出Kl_Squared_Radius,Kl_Squared_Radius小于等于Squared_Radius,則認為傳感器數據中包含當前Sphere,并可通過Sphere中的zone_key得到當前正在刷牙到區域;
所述步驟三建立3d牙齒模型根據計算得出的覆蓋率渲染牙齒模型并展示包括:
3.1:通過3d建模工具設計一個牙齒模型,并可以使用代碼邏輯控制任何一個牙齒區域到材質顏色,定義顏色越淺,刷牙到覆蓋率越高,清潔度越高;
3.2:覆蓋率計算方法為:定義一個牙齒區域需要刷牙的時間為each_zone_time=刷牙周期/16,一個牙齒的有效刷牙時間為容器passes的有效時間總和current_zone_effective_time則覆蓋率quality=current_zone_effective_time/each_zone_time;
3.3:設置一個定時器,每0.5秒去使用根據齒區相似度匹配算法公式計算得出7.5秒內總共的牙齒區域編號,并算出覆蓋率;
3.4:通過計算得出的覆蓋率,重新渲染牙齒模型,并展示。
2.根據權利要求1所述的一種基于傳感器的牙齒區域識別算法的刷牙引導系統,其特征在于所述的刷牙引導系統還包括顯示器。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于中山極冠科技有限公司,未經中山極冠科技有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/202210414511.2/1.html,轉載請聲明來源鉆瓜專利網。





